NRSG 1150 - Medical Terminology



Credit hours: 1 (lecture)

Course Description:
This course is a basic study of the development and usage of medical terminology.

Student Learning Outcomes:
Upon successful completion of this course the student will:

  1. Identify the role and recognize examples of word roots, prefixes, suffixes, and combining forms in developing medical terms.
  2. Demonstrate correct usage of the combining vowel by correctly joining word parts to write and analyze medical terms.
  3. Demonstrate the correct spelling of medical terms.
  4. Pronounce medical terms correctly.
  5. Recognize and define terms pertaining to sciences of the human body and field of medicine.
  6. Write the meaning of medical abbreviations and use the abbreviations appropriately.
  7. Differentiate terms as being related to diagnosis, anatomy, surgery, therapy, or radiology.
